vue是干什么的语言
-
Vue.js是一种用于构建用户界面的JavaScript框架。它通过使用组件化的方式来实现UI的搭建,同时提供了响应式的数据绑定和简洁的语法。Vue.js旨在简化前端开发的复杂性,提高开发效率。
具体来说,Vue.js可以帮助开发者构建交互丰富、动态的网页应用。它提供了一整套工具和库,包括模板语法、数据绑定、组件化和虚拟DOM等。这些特性使得开发者可以更简单地管理和更新UI,并能够实现高度可复用的组件,提升开发效率和代码的可维护性。
除了简化开发流程,Vue.js还具有良好的性能表现。通过使用虚拟DOM技术,它可以高效地更新DOM,并优化了多次渲染的效率。同时,Vue.js还支持异步组件和代码分割,使得应用可以按需加载,提高了网页的加载速度和性能。
总的来说,Vue.js是一种灵活、高效的前端框架,提供了丰富的特性和工具,使得开发者可以更轻松地构建现代化的Web应用。它已经成为了当今前端开发中非常流行和广泛使用的框架之一。
2年前 -
Vue是一种用于构建交互式的Web界面的现代JavaScript框架。它被设计为一种响应式的框架,可以通过声明式的方式来处理数据驱动的用户界面。以下是关于Vue的几个核心功能和特性:
-
响应式数据绑定:Vue使用一种称为"响应式数据绑定"的机制,将应用程序的数据与用户界面的状态同步。当数据发生变化时,界面会自动更新。这种数据绑定机制可以大大简化开发过程,并提高开发效率。
-
组件化开发:Vue允许开发者将整个页面划分为小的、可重用的组件。每个组件包含了自己的结构、样式和行为,可以独立开发和测试。组件化开发提供了更好的代码组织和维护,并且可以实现代码的复用。
-
虚拟DOM:Vue使用虚拟DOM来提高性能。当数据发生变化时,Vue会计算出一个新的虚拟DOM树,并通过比较新旧虚拟DOM树的差异,只更新需要变化的部分,这样可以避免不必要的DOM操作,提高页面渲染效率。
-
插件化扩展:Vue提供了丰富的插件化扩展机制,可以通过插件来扩展Vue的功能。开发者可以根据自己的需求,选择合适的插件来增强Vue的能力,如路由管理、状态管理等。
-
设计友好的API:Vue提供了简洁、灵活和易于理解的API,使得开发者可以更快地上手和开发。Vue的API文档和教程也非常详细和友好,对于初学者来说,学习和使用Vue非常方便。
总的来说,Vue是一种功能强大、易学易用的前端框架,它使开发者能够快速构建高效、交互式的Web界面。无论是小型项目还是大型项目,Vue都能够提供出色的开发体验和性能。
2年前 -
-
Vue是一种流行的JavaScript框架,用于构建用户界面。它采用了组件化的开发方式,通过将界面拆分为多个可复用、独立的组件,来实现高效的开发和维护。
Vue的主要特点包括:
-
响应式数据绑定:Vue使用双向数据绑定的方式,实现了数据和视图的自动同步。当数据发生更改时,视图会自动更新,反之亦然。
-
组件化开发:Vue鼓励使用组件化开发,允许将界面分解为多个独立、可复用的组件。每个组件可以拥有自己的状态和行为,可以相互组合形成更复杂的应用。
-
虚拟DOM:Vue使用虚拟DOM来提高渲染性能。它通过在内存中生成一颗虚拟的DOM树,然后将其与实际DOM进行比较,并最小化实际DOM的操作数量,从而提高性能。
-
插件系统:Vue拥有丰富的插件系统,可以轻松地扩展其功能。开发者可以使用现有的插件,或者自己编写插件来增强Vue的功能。
使用Vue开发一个应用的一般步骤如下:
-
引入Vue:在HTML文件中引入Vue库。
-
创建Vue实例:通过实例化Vue构造函数来创建一个Vue实例。
-
数据绑定:将数据绑定到HTML模板中,使用Vue的模板语法。
-
组件开发:将界面拆分为多个组件,并编写各个组件的模板、逻辑和样式。
-
事件处理:在组件中添加事件处理函数,以响应用户的操作。
-
虚拟DOM和渲染:由Vue自动管理虚拟DOM,通过数据的变化来更新视图。
-
插件扩展:根据需要,可以引入第三方插件,或者自己编写插件来扩展Vue的功能。
总的来说,Vue是一种方便、高效的JavaScript框架,可以帮助开发者快速构建现代化的Web应用。它的易用性、高效性以及丰富的生态系统使得它成为了前端开发者的首选框架之一。
2年前 -